Introduction to the L90 Electric Wheel Loader

After an impressive achievement of over 100 million all-electric miles with their fleet of semi-trucks, Volvo is making significant strides in the world of electric construction equipment. The latest addition to their lineup, the L90 Electric Wheel Loader, has begun its journey, reaching its first customers and setting new standards for performance and sustainability.

Innovative Features and Benefits

Unveiled during last summer’s Volvo Days event, the L90 Electric Wheel Loader boasts dedicated electric motors for both propulsion and hydraulics. This innovative design offers faster responses and shorter cycle times compared to traditional diesel models. With a powerful performance allowing for continuous operation of 4-5 hours, and up to 8 hours in lighter applications, this machine ensures it can handle the demands of any job site efficiently.

Real-World Applications and Impact

What’s more exciting is the L90 Electric’s first deployment at a groundbreaking for a new data center, showcasing its capabilities in a real-world setting. Not only does this electric wheel loader provide the flexibility and functionality of its diesel counterparts, but it also significantly reduces on-site emissions and noise. This is a remarkable move toward a greener future in construction, aligning with global sustainability goals.
